Introduces a comprehensive, multi-tiered memory system to provide conversation history and context for the AI agent. This lays the foundation for more stateful and intelligent interactions.
Key components of this implementation:
- **Multi-Tiered Memory Architecture:**
- **Tier 1 (Working Memory):** A fast, in-memory buffer (`ConversationBufferMemory`) that holds the most recent turns of a conversation for immediate access.
- **Tier 3 (Long-Term Memory):** A persistent, semantic search-based memory store using Qdrant (`QdrantConversationMemory`). It stores all conversation turns as vector embeddings, enabling long-term recall and similarity search.
- **Qdrant Integration:**
- The `qdrant-client` is added to manage collections and perform vector search operations.
- Each user is assigned a dedicated Qdrant collection for multi-tenancy.
- **Ollama Embedding Client:**
- A new `OllamaEmbeddingClient` generates text embeddings via the Ollama API, replacing the need for local sentence-transformer models. This significantly reduces the service's dependency footprint.
- **Configuration and Stack Updates:**
- The `config.py` and `core-ai.yml` stack file are updated with new settings for enabling memory, configuring Qdrant, and specifying the embedding model.
- **Utility and Schema Additions:**
- New Pydantic schemas (`memory/schemas.py`) define the data structures for conversation turns and memory management.
- Utility functions (`utils.py`) are added for user ID sanitization and collection naming.
This feature enhances the agent's capabilities by allowing it to maintain context across multiple turns and sessions, leading to more coherent and relevant responses.
